Output 15b356e8d839dd7c03956a2c66b3830b78c6dd9d6bbe91b740c918c42972967f:3

value
106146362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d146e45806b5c867a1264067cac9676db86fdbf9 OP_EQUAL
address
3Lma5JA4NxHvrAbb6LyxafeorFK5Z2BQp2
transaction
15b356e8d839dd7c03956a2c66b3830b78c6dd9d6bbe91b740c918c42972967f
spent
true